> >I do wish someone made an affordable IR exposure meter...
> >
> Theo, have you looked at the recommendation by Andrew Davidhazy (RIT). He
> suggests covering your hand held meter's cell with the same material you
> are using to filter your camera. I don't remmember which IR site has it(I
> lost my addresses several months ago in a tragic crash}, but for using an
> 87c filter he suggests using a piece of the same material over the light
> opening on a Gossen Luno Pro and exposing at EI 2400 for HIE. I have
> tried
> it with my inexpensive Gossen Super Pilot and it works. Just cut a small
> piece of gelatin or polyester and slip it in the front. I use EI 3200
> because I have been using T-Max developer. This is intended for use with
> an 87c filter mounted behind the shutter so you can use your SLR hand
> held.
> It should be able to work with any filter material you want.
